#dd8991 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d8991 is composed of 86.7% red, 53.7%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38% magenta, 34.4%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 354.3 degrees, a saturation of 55.3% and a lightness of 70.2%. #dd8991 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bb1323.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#dd8991 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d8991 has RGB values of R:221, G:137,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.34,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14518673.
